Why is my electric towel rail not getting hot?

If the towel rail is still not hot to touch the element is probably undersized (there may not be an alternative because the next size up may be too big). Fluid level (if liquid filled) should be checked; it should be approximately 90% full. Dry element towel rails have a much better spread of heat.

Can you use a radiator without a thermostat?

Standard practice is to leave one radiator without a thermostatic radiator valve installed, and to leave that appliance permanently switched on. If your boiler is fitted with a flow meter that detects when all of your radiator valves are closed, you can install a TRV on every radiator if you want to.

Do towel rails use much electricity?

The short answer is, not a lot. Most heated towel rails are very effective in heating and drying your towels. In other words, they don't use a lot of electricity to perform their job. To provide a bit more detail, the typical heated towel rails consumes 100 to 200 watts of electricity per hour.4 Sept 2021
